Title:
Windows 10 is detected as Windows 8
Status in os-prober package in Ubuntu:
Fix Released
Bug description:
Steps to reproduce:
* Clean pc
* Install Windows 8.1, let it use the entire disk
* Dual boot installation Ubuntu 15.04.
* Verify that that Grub shows Windows 8 when booting up
* Verify that you can boot into Windows from the grub menu
* Verify that you can boot into Ubuntu from the grub menu
* Verify that os-prober detects "Windows 8 (loader)" on sda1
* Upgrade Windows 8.1 to Windows 10
* (Additional steps may be required to restore grub after Windows upgrade)
* Verify that you can boot into Windows 10 from the grub menu
* Verify that you can boot into Ubuntu from the grub menu
* Run os-prober
Expected result:
/dev/sda1:Windows 10 (loader):Windows:chain
Actual result:
/dev/sda1:Windows 8 (loader):Windows:chain
Ubuntu 15.04
os-prober 1.63ubuntu1
